Nebraska Indian Community College

Macy, Nebraska

What is this TCU known for?

Chartered in 1979 by three Nebraska Indian Tribes (Omaha, Santee Sioux, Winnebago), NICC operates across multiple reservation locations and an urban campus. The multi-campus structure provides individualized attention even across distances. NICC has been involved in national research on culturally grounded assessment practices.
